Paul Pierce fumbled away two critical late game plays that might have made the difference in a tight ballgame. It ruined a game in which Pierce looked spry and effective early on and Rajon Rondo got yet another triple double. However, Carmelo got some measure of revenge with a big 28 point night and the Celtics skid is now up to 5 games.

The Celtics lost five straight twice last season before rallying at the end of the season for a 37-29 record and the Atlantic Division title. They may not be as lucky this season as the Atlantic-leading Knicks improved to 26-14, seven games ahead of the 20-22 Celtics in the division.

After Garnett spilled to the floor trying to complete a third-quarter alley-oop, it was Anthony -- of all people -- who offered a hand to help pick him up. After all the hoopla in New York, the two played nice on Thursday and Garnett actually got under the skin of Tyson Chandler more than Anthony on this night.
